There are two fundamental kinds of sand filtering; sluggish sand filtering and also fast sand purification. Slowsand filtration is a biological procedure, because it uses bacteria to deal with the water. his comment is here The bacteriaestablish an area on the leading layer of sand as well as clean the water as it travels through, bydigesting the pollutants in the water.

As a result of the land area that is needed and also the down-time for cleansing, fast sand filters, which were created in the early 20 th century, are a lot a lot more widespread today. Quick sand filtering is a physical process that eliminates suspended solids from the water. Rapid sand filtering is far more typical than circulation sand filtration, due to the fact that quick sand filters have relatively high circulation rates and need reasonably little space to operate.
